A senior BSP leader, who has closely observed the party’s functioning for years, believed that Mayawati had acted against Akash to nip in the bud any possibility of him emerging as a parallel power structure. Party insiders claim that Mayawati has a strong feeling that Akash Anand is still under the influence of his now-expelled father-in-law. They want to influence candidate selection and fundraising in states, she believes. By promoting Ishan and downgrading Akash, she has indicated to her party that no one but she has the power to control the party. In a follow-up exercise to Akash’s removal, she has taken full charge of the election in the state most crucial for the BSP. A party document circulated among top leaders shows that, from now on, all matters regarding two poll-bound states — Uttar Pradesh and Uttarakhand — will be dealt with directly from the Lucknow headquarters. This puts the party vice president and Mayawati’s brother, Anand Kumar, in a piquant situation. Both Akash and Ishan are his sons. He has lived under the shadow of his sister’s towering figure. Akash’s big moment had come in 2022 when he was made the national coordinator and given charge of poll-bound Chhattisgarh, Rajasthan, and Madhya Pradesh. On September 10, 2023, Mayawati anointed him her successor at a national-level party meet. On May 7, 2024, Mayawati posted on X that Akash was being stripped of two significant responsibilities till he attained maturity. But on June 23, 2024, he was back as BSP’s National Coordinator and Mayawati’s heir. But in March 2025, the axe fell for the second time. On March 2, 2025, Mayawati again ejected him from the two roles. On April 13, 2025, Akash issued a public apology and was readmitted to the party. In August 2025, Mayawati created a new national convenor post and promoted Akash to it.
